> >> I was in the city shooting façades for a client last month and I took
> >> the opportunity to grab a quick shot for myself (have hardly shot
> >> anything for myself in the last two years).
> >>
> >> The image was shot using my pano head with the vertical angle set to
> >> optimise the balance between the road and the tops of the buildings.
> >> It's a 3 shot x 12 HDR sequence, all assembled in LR using the HDR
> >> panorama option. I then used the guided transform tool to set my main
> >> verticals and rotation.
> >>
> >> I had a cut down kit with me which meant that I had to set the tripod
> >> level by adjusting the leg lengths so it's not quite right, I left the
> >> image uncropped to display the overlap/stitching (and my levelling
> >> error).
